Non-vegetarian Now Available In Howrah-Kamakhya Vande Bharat Sleeper, IRCTC Gives New Food Option To Passengers

IRCTC also gave the option of non-vegetarian food to the passengers.

Jagran correspondent, New Delhi. Now there will be option of non-vegetarian food along with vegetarian food in Howrah-Kamakhya and Kamakhya-Howrah Vande Bharat Sleeper Express.

Under this new facility operated by Indian Railway Catering and Tourism Corporation Limited (IRCTC), special attention has been paid to the quality, taste and nutrition of food.

Passenger preferences and regional tastes have been given priority in the non-vegetarian options. The new food arrangement will help in making this long distance journey more convenient and memorable. According to IRCTC, keeping in mind the changing needs and expectations of passengers, such facilities will be implemented in other trains in a phased manner in the future.
